Airstream and Porsche join forces to build ULTRA-COOL electric camper

TRAILER MANUFACTURER Airstream and Porsche have joined forces to build an ultra-cool electric camper.

The camper is designed to be pulled by a small SUV or an electric vehicle – and is built of composite materials such as carbon fibre to help reduce weight.

The 4.99-metre long Airstream Studio F.A. includes a kitchenette with a sink, stove, storage space, and seating that transforms from a dining area into a full-size bed.

The seats are located in the front and can be folded into a bed or kept upright so campers can use the centre table.

The reclining seat options allow owners to enjoy the views through the open hatch.

And the wet bath is incorporated into the front roadside corner and features a door that creates an enclosed, private area which can conceal the toilet when it’s not in use.

The carbon-fibre pop-up roof creates additional headroom, while the camper has adjustable-height suspension that allows the owners to store the trailer in their garage.

The concept design integrates numerous advanced in aerodynamics, too, including a new rear shape intended to improve airflow.

There are integrated rooftop solar panels and lithium battery storage to conserve energy, making it ideal for off-grid camping.

However, Porsche and Airstream have not revealed prices – but Airstream currently sells trailers from £42,000 to £170,000.

Bob Wheeler, Airstream’s CEO, explained: “Our collaboration with Studio F. A. Porsche brought talented new eyes and minds to our never-ending process of improving the Airstream experience.

“It’s a fresh design approach aimed at reaching a broader, more diverse base of potential customers.

“Like earlier concepts, the Airstream Studio F. A. Porsche Concept Travel Trailer builds on Airstream’s design DNA and our commitment to aerodynamics to create a vision that is both familiar and excitingly new.

“While our concept projects don’t always reach the marketplace, the resulting lessons and innovations often influence present and future designs as they make their way into our main product lines.”

The concept will be showcased at Porsche’s SXSW exhibit in Austin, Texas, where Airstream and Porsche Lifestyle group executives will unveil a 1/3 scale model of the camper and a Porsche Macan tow vehicle.
